Glutamate receptors: desensitizing dimers

Curr Biol. 2002 Sep 17;12(18):R631-2. doi: 10.1016/s0960-9822(02)01138-7.

Abstract

Recent structural studies show, not only how the desensitization of a ligand-gated ion channel with bound agonist can be rationalized in terms of subunit-subunit instability, but also how a previously unknown mode of interaction may provide clues into how the receptor is tetramerically assembled in vivo.
